The supporting sub-structure forms the static connection between the structure and the façade cladding. Preferred materials used for the supporting system are metal and timber, or a combination of both. Basically a structural analysis for supporting system is required, this applies to new builds as well as to restoration works.
The structural-physical requirements must be taken into account. Fixings method and material is dependent on the material of the building structure, expected loads and fire safety requirements. The function and dimensions of the supporting system should be verified on both new builds and renovations as well as the fasteners to be used, depending on the material of the supporting system.
Generally speaking, the structural stability analysis covers the supporting system, including anchors and connectors, as well as the cladding and its fastenings.
The fastenings specified represent the base fastening of the respective products. In the case of increased wind loads, it may be necessary to increase or decrease the number of fastenings depending on the object or to use screwed fastenings instead of nailed ones.
Provide all relevant information regarding supporting system spacings to the carpenter and monitor workmanship carefully. PREFA small-format products must be installed as façade cladding on a fully boarded wooden substrate or, depending on fire protection requirements, on metal trapezoidal deck.
Minimum requirement: The fully supported substrate must be executed in accordance with national standards and regulations. * National standards and guidelines must be taken into account.
Sheets made of wood-based materials
When using wood-based sheets as a substrate for PREFA façade coverings, the choice of thickness, the mounting to the wood-based material and the intended use as a metal roof substrate must be agreed with the manufacturer and/or distributor of the wood-based sheets.
Note
PREFA does not recommend the use of OSB sheets as a substrate for metal roofing with or without a separation layer.
